Green-tech Wins Supplier of the Year at APL Awards 2023

Lesley Spencein Industry News

The Green-tech team are celebrating after being named the Supplier of the Year at the recent Association of Professional Landscapers (APL) Awards 2023.

MD Kris Nellist centre front with some of the Green-tech team

The Awards which have taken place every year since 1995, took place on Friday 17th March at The Brewery in London. Hosted by garden designer and TV presenter Diarmuid Gavin, the awards recognise and celebrate the outstanding landscaping carried out by members of the APL.

Green-tech's Managing Director Kris Nellist comments, "I was thrilled to hear we had won the APL Supplier of the Year award. This is an award that the APL members vote for so it's especially meaningful. The whole team work hard to ensure we offer the best products, price, and service so I am particularly proud of them to be acknowledged in this way."

The Supplier of the Year Award is Sponsored by Perennial, the UK's only charity dedicated to helping everyone who works in horticulture, and their families, when times get tough.

Green-tech is a staunch supporter of the landscaping industry; themselves sponsoring a category at the APL awards - Commercial Maintenance, which was won by HM Gardens Limited for their Rainbow project.

Kris continues, "Green-tech is in its 29th trading year and I'm proud that the company maintains its market leading position and is recognised by our customers and industry alike for offering outstanding service. The company continues to grow and develop, constantly looking for new products to meet our customers' needs, particularly around sustainability and environmental agendas. Recent products to be added to our portfolio include a new urban tree planting cell system, TreeParker, Greentree Bioretention soils and NexGen - 100% Biodegradable tree shelters.
